From the Guidelines

High TSH with low free T4 indicates primary hypothyroidism, which requires treatment with levothyroxine (synthetic thyroid hormone). The typical starting dose for adults is 1.6 mcg/kg/day, usually 50-100 mcg daily, taken on an empty stomach 30-60 minutes before breakfast 1. Medication should be taken consistently at the same time each day, avoiding calcium, iron supplements, and certain foods within 4 hours of taking it as they can interfere with absorption.

Some key points to consider in the management of primary hypothyroidism include:

  • The goal of treatment is to normalize TSH (typically 0.5-4.5 mIU/L) and free T4 levels 1.
  • Follow-up blood tests are needed 6-8 weeks after starting treatment to check TSH and T4 levels, with dose adjustments made accordingly 1.
  • Common causes of primary hypothyroidism include Hashimoto's thyroiditis (an autoimmune condition), iodine deficiency, or previous thyroid surgery/radiation 1.
  • Symptoms may include fatigue, weight gain, cold intolerance, constipation, dry skin, and depression, which should improve with proper treatment 1.

From the Research

High TSH and Low Free T4

  • High TSH levels and low free T4 levels are indicative of overt hypothyroidism, a condition where the thyroid gland does not produce enough thyroid hormones 2.
  • Overt hypothyroidism is often characterized by symptoms such as fatigue, weight gain, and sensitivity to cold, and is typically treated with levothyroxine (LT4) therapy 2, 3.
  • The goal of LT4 therapy is to normalize serum TSH levels and restore the body's reservoir of triiodothyronine (T3), which is essential for maintaining normal metabolism and overall health 3, 4.
  • However, some patients may not respond adequately to LT4 monotherapy and may require combination therapy with LT4 and liothyronine (LT3) or desiccated thyroid extract (DTE) 3, 5, 6.
  • Studies have shown that combination therapy can lead to improved T3 levels and reduced T4 levels, but its effects on quality of life and patient satisfaction are still being researched and debated 5, 6.

Treatment Options

  • Levothyroxine (LT4) monotherapy is the most commonly used treatment for hypothyroidism, and is usually started at a dose of 1.5 microg/kg per day 2.
  • Combination therapy with LT4 and LT3 can be considered for patients who do not respond adequately to LT4 monotherapy, and typically involves reducing the LT4 dose and adding 2.5-7.5 mcg of LT3 once or twice a day 3.
  • Desiccated thyroid extract (DTE) is another option for combination therapy, and contains a mixture of T4 and T3 in a ratio of approximately 4:1 3, 6.
  • The choice of treatment should be individualized and based on the patient's specific needs and circumstances, and should be monitored regularly to ensure optimal outcomes 2, 5, 6.
